Company Overview

Bridgestone Americas, Inc. (BSAM), headquartered in Nashville, Tennessee, and Bridgestone Europe, Middle East and Africa (BSEMEA), headquartered in Brussels, Belgium, operate collectively as a “Bridgestone West” strategic region. This region services the strategic business needs of teams across the Americas, Europe, Middle East and Africa. BSAM and BSEMEA are subsidiaries of Bridgestone Corporation, globally headquartered in Japan. Bridgestone and its subsidiaries develop, manufacture and market a wide range of Bridgestone, Firestone and associate brand products and solutions to address the needs of a broad range of customers and industries.

Responsibilities

Market Quality

  • Assisting in identifying, securing, and developing fleet partners for commercial evaluations.
  • Manage the logistics of materials procurement, tire building, and mounting between Bandag manufacturing, Bridgestone Customer Support, Bandag Dealers, and fleet development partners to assure accurate test configurations are maintained.
  • Participate in surveys – coordinate and participate in surveys for information on current product performance and usage in the field. Coordinate and collect tires for regional tire surveys.
  • Determine and confirm product performance in the field for product development purposes. Investigate and initiate new product requests based on field evaluation and market awareness.

 

Service Quality

  • Be able to recognize tire conditions, manufacturing anomalies, and analyze tires removed from service to determine removal condition and probable cause.
  • Review of all invoices from Dealers & Fleets resulting from test agreements and the subsequent writing and submitting of credits.
  • Collect and provide information on new tires, competitive, and prototype retreads within the assigned area.
  • Make presentations and formulate plans to present evaluation data to evaluation partners, dealers, and field sales representatives.
  • Maintain and continually build relationships with fleet sales and dealer alliance members.
  • Collect, analyze, and report market trends – investigate and report competitor activity to regional management and Corporate Sales Engineering. Analyze market trends and recommend product line enhancements.

What you need to know about the Chicago Tech Scene

With vibrant neighborhoods, great food and more affordable housing than either coast, Chicago might be the most liveable major tech hub. It is the birthplace of modern commodities and futures trading, a national hub for logistics and commerce, and home to the American Medical Association and the American Bar Association. This diverse blend of industry influences has helped Chicago emerge as a major player in verticals like fintech, biotechnology, legal tech, e-commerce and logistics technology. It’s also a major hiring center for tech companies on both coasts.

Key Facts About Chicago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 245,800; 5.2%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: McDonald’s, John Deere, Boeing, Morningstar
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, biotechnology, fintech, software, logistics technology
  • Funding Landscape: $2.5 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Pritzker Group Venture Capital, Arch Venture Partners, MATH Venture Partners, Jump Capital, Hyde Park Venture Partners
  • Research Centers and Universities: Northwestern University, University of Chicago, University of Illinois Urbana-Champaign, Illinois Institute of Technology, Argonne National Laboratory, Fermi National Accelerator Laboratory
